Transaction 6dbc51e3bd70fbdc4d42eda4d731a649c1aa36f25eb51baa0371c02497314731

10 Input
2 Outputs
  • 6dbc51e3bd70fbdc4d42eda4d731a649c1aa36f25eb51baa0371c02497314731:0
  • value  24939348
    address  1BBEm8xvAMX1K25BrQT1rMegByMT3ybrAh
  • 6dbc51e3bd70fbdc4d42eda4d731a649c1aa36f25eb51baa0371c02497314731:1
  • value  462937
    address  31wC4QqdGUhoeUCM5bMSkzSQAAkXh4a1mc